Output 31e7ba0f9a25aed2ec1a5d568b35d7c36a4700ab4ffee21d9e5a888abc88cfd9:0

value
608580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0abda49e111c0c9427d76921b37f4424e671053 OP_EQUAL
address
3KFmXuhXCWUULMdoUtLnB3wf3cPbEVV5nW
transaction
31e7ba0f9a25aed2ec1a5d568b35d7c36a4700ab4ffee21d9e5a888abc88cfd9
spent
true